If the unit is moved from a cold location to a warm location or used in areas with high humidity,
the moisture in the air may adhere as water droplets on the head drum. This is called condensa-
tion, and if the tape is run under these conditions, it will easily stick to the drum. Therefore, the
following points should be observed.
¡If the unit is moved under conditions where condensation may occur, eject the tape.
¡Before inserting the tape, set the POWER switch to ON and check that the HUMID display in
the display window is not lit. If the HUMID display is lit, do not insert the tape until the display
goes off.
Use the AJ-CL12MP cleaning cassette when head cleaning is required. Improper use of the
cleaning cassette may damage the video heads. Therefore, read the Handling Instructions for
the cleaning tape carefully before use.
¡Do not use thinner or other solvents to remove dirt from the viewfinder.
¡Wipe the lens with lens cleaner available on the market.
¡Absolutely do not wipe the mirror. If dirt, etc. has adhered to the mirror, remove it using a air
blower available on the market.
Smear
Smear occurs when shooting high-intensity subjects, and occurs more easily as the electronic
shutter speed increases.
